Standard Schnauzer - Working Group

Originating in Germany, the Standard Schnauzer is used to rat and guard. Their coat is wiry and can be found in pepper and black or pure black. Their coat needs combing weekly and scissoring and shaping yearly. Known as simply a household pet and guardian it is a dog thay may seem intimidating due it's seriousness. Standard Schnauzer's are alert and highly intelligent. They became beloved dogs in show due to their sharp looks. At the marketplace they became the most popular dog's for guarding carts. Today they are most popular in the show and obedience rings. For a dog that is versatile they have also been used in police work. Some Schnauzer's may be dog aggressive, suspicious of strangers and mischievous. Loyal to their family, the Schnauzer is a dog that will guard and protect those who are closest to it. They are full of energy and would enjoy playing games for hours as well as going on long walks. Standing 17-20 inches and weighing 35-45 lbs the Standard Schnauzer is a great dog to own and take seriously.
